Types of fishing reel
A good fishing reel, along with a good fishing rod, makes your fishing experience wonderful. To choose the right fishing reel, you need to know the types of the fishing reel.
Spincast Fishing Reel
The spincast fishing reel is a popular type of fishing reel. It’s easy to use and maintain at the time of catching fishes. There has a simple button that facilitates your fishing experience. You will get more control at the time of throwing the line into the water. The spincast lessens the chance for occurring the line twist.
The spinning reel
The spinning reel is also a popular type of reel for its versatility and adaptability. You can easily change between bait types without implications on the cast. You also can cast the line more further with a spinning reel than the casting with a spincast reel.
The baitcasting fishing reel
As this type of reel requires a lot of skill and practice, a beginner should not use it. The baitcasting reel offers the most distance and accuracy, and so the professional anglers like this reel.

Materials of the reel
Anodized aluminum and graphite are two popular types of materials used to produce the fishing reel. If you are going big fishes that require greater strength and rigidity, you need to buy a reel made of aluminum. A reel made of graphite is lighter and comfortable for beginners.
Anti-reverse Handle
The anti-reverse handle on a reel prevents the reel from turning backward. It allows the angler to choose engaging and not-engaging options.
Gear Ratio
The reel’s gear ratio means the number of spool turning on when rotating the handles. It also indicates the extent of the quickness of retrieving. The type of lures you use at the time of fishing also affects the right gear ratio.

Frequently Asked Question
What is the easiest fishing reel?
The spincast reel is the easiest fishing reel among the many type of fishing reel. You don’t need to the professional level skills and experiences to operate this type of fishing reel.
What do the numbers mean on fishing reels?
Sometimes we become confused about seeing the numbers on the fishing reel. These numbers such as 4000, 3000, 1000 indicate the diameter of the fishing reel. You sometimes see the numbers like 5.4 :1 or 6.3:1. The first number of this type of number indicates the rotation of the spool per one turning of reel’s handle.
What do bearings mean in fishing reels?
The ball bearing of the fishing reels lessens the friction of making it easy to reel the thread. You need to move the spool easily to reach the lure to your desired place. At the time of casting and rolling the thread, the bearings help a lot.
